原文:为什么要使用内部类+匿名类

Java 内部类有什么好处 为什么需要内部类 转载 首先举一个简单的例子,如果你想实现一个接口,但是这个接口中的一个方法和你构想的这个类中的一个 方法的名称,参数相同,你应该怎么办 这时候,你可以建一个内部类实现这个接口。由于内部类对外部类的所有内容都是可访问的,所以这样做可以完成所有你直 接实现这个接口的功能。 不过你可能要质疑,更改一下方法的不就行了吗 的确,以此作为设计内部类的理由,实在没有 ...

2013-02-18 22:13 0 7078 推荐指数:

查看详情

匿名内部类使用

目标 1,匿名内部类的作用。 2,匿名内部类的定义格式。 具体内容 匿名内部类的定义: 没有名字的内部类。表面上看起来那是它的名字,实际上不是它的名字。 使用匿名内部类的前提: 必须继承父类或实现一个接口 匿名内部类的分类: 1.继承式的匿名内部类 2.接口式的匿名内部类 ...

Tue Jun 14 02:11:00 CST 2016 1 6324
Android里面的匿名匿名内部类使用

在android开发中经常碰到匿名(和匿名内部类)的使用,那么匿名和一般情况下使用有什么不同, 从实现的功能来讲是一样的,但是使用匿名更加简洁方便,形式上有点像new一个接口或的感觉,但是我们必须 记住接口是不可以new出来的(实例化),我们要在内部重写需要的接口的方法 ...

Wed Jan 18 20:34:00 CST 2012 0 10760
Java:匿名匿名内部类

本文内容: 内部类 匿名 首发日期 :2018-03-25 内部类: 在一个中定义另一个,这样定义的称为内部类。【包含内部类可以称为内部类的外部类】 如果想要通过一个使用另一个,可以定义为内部类。【比如苹果手机,苹果手机中 ...

Sun Mar 25 22:48:00 CST 2018 5 34851
什么是匿名内部类,如何使用匿名内部类

匿名内部类 匿名内部类,就是没有名字的一种嵌套。它是Java对的定义方式之一。 为什么要使用匿名内部类 在实际开发中,我们常常遇到这样的情况:一个接口/的方法的某个实现方式在程序中只会执行一次,但为了使用它,我们需要创建它的实现/子类去实现/重写。此时可以使用匿名内部类的方式 ...

Thu Nov 12 22:09:00 CST 2020 0 871
匿名内部类

匿名内部类也就是没有名字的内部类 使用匿名内部类有个前提条件:必须继承一个父类或实现一个接口。 例1:不使用匿名内部类来实现抽象方法 可以看到,我们用Child继承了Person,然后实现了Child的一个实例,将其向上转型为Person的引用。 例2:匿名内部类的基本实现 例 ...

Thu May 27 00:34:00 CST 2021 0 1764
匿名内部类

一.匿名内部类适合创建那种只需要一次使用(命令模式) (1)定义匿名内部类的格式: new 实现接口( ) |父类构造器(实参列表) { //匿名内部类的实体部分 ...

Thu Sep 27 05:47:00 CST 2018 1 2227
匿名内部类

一、使用匿名内部类内部类 匿名内部类由于没有名字,所以它的创建方式有点儿奇怪。创建格式如下: 在这里我们看到使用匿名内部类我们必须要继承一个父类或者实现一个接口,当然也仅能只继承一个父类或者实现一个接口 ...

Fri Nov 10 22:29:00 CST 2017 0 1122
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M